Another great golf putting training suggestion is to practice on a green for practice. Find a flat spot on the practice green. Stick your tee about two or three feet away from the cup. To get a feel of the green make short putts. Remember that 80% of your golf putts are within the range of three to 10 feet. If you can practice 100 consecutive putts in a row with confidence you’ll increase your odds of making birdies and lower scores.

In the course of golf putting, you’ll learn the proper mechanics of the putter. To accomplish this, you have to stand at the correct angle to the line of your target and swing back in a pendulum-like motion. The line that you want to hit must be at the right angle so that the putter’s face is in line with it. Otherwise the target will be missed. You will miss your shot if do not maintain the right angle during your putting training.

The stance you use is also crucial. In contrast to the stance you take when you’re teeing off, the stance in golf putting training must be aligned with your ball’s center line.
